|
一、 制造工程师2008新版本功能概述
. e2 @( u2 t1 l- j. h y7 g% L$ JCAXA制造工程师是具有卓越工艺性的数控编程CAM软件,它高效易学,为数控加工行业提供了从造型、设计到加工代码生成、加工仿真、代码校验等一体化的解决方案,是数控机床真正的“大脑”。CAXA制造工程师软件不仅融合了很多国外高速加工技术以及多轴加工技术,而且还具备优秀的后置处理技术,另外它在代码反读和代码转换方面有非常强的优势。 : Y2 ^0 P& T) B0 ]" w3 a; X2 T
CAXA制造工程师2008版包含特征实体造型、自由曲面造型和两轴到五轴的数控加工等重要功能。在CAXA制造工程师2006版的基础上,还对原有功能做了增强、改进,尤其是:可用于代码转换、手工编程和宏程序的编程助手模块;针对五轴模块新增了曲线加工、曲面区域加工、叶轮A系列粗加工和精加工、五轴轨迹转四轴轨迹等功能;针对四轴模块增强了铣槽能力,更新了四轴后置,支持360度连续角度;更新了系统License检查,适应大规模应用场景。
0 d" I6 \5 M' i二、 新增功能介绍
' e7 J2 A C: n9 G, d1 cCAXA制造工程师2008版新增了许多功能,在此着重介绍与实际加工息息相关的加工方面的新增功能。CAXA制造工程师2008最新版本加工功能从加工方式的角度进一步增强完善了,尤其是增加了根据特定的造型提供的倒圆角加工的宏加工方式。宏加工的功能是根据给定的平面轮廓曲线,生成加工圆角的轨迹和带有宏指令的加工代码。该功能充分利用了Fanuc系统的宏程序功能,使得倒圆角的加工程序变得异常简单灵活。
1 i: v8 n: Y s: G1 W/ X/ `" q# }$ t进入CAXA制造工程师2008新版后,单击“加工”下拉菜单,“宏加工”→“倒圆角”显示如图1所示。 ; r; Z+ f2 l( d, E! k* P2 I9 [
) }, \) B; F$ e$ D. L图1 宏加工的选择界面1、 参数说明 7 d i5 S, p) ~( M
' `$ V0 ~+ }6 @9 ^7 I点取“加工”→“宏加工”→“倒圆角”弹出如图2所示对话框: ' M0 |( v; ?: @ g" o2 e; }, Y
9 k' C* t: Y' e/ f' d1 E% b图2 宏加工参数设置
1 t! V$ [: y* h; u% C(1)圆角半径: - g4 G' N* H. f" \0 [
倒圆角的半径值。圆角的半径值一定要小于轮廓的拐角半径值。 " r! G: I9 S! b+ y T3 K
(2)圆心角增量: ' K' l) I" _6 ^/ ]) g: q; q- w
倒圆角是由多层轨迹形成。每层轨迹是由起始角向结束角变化,再由每一个变化的角度值计算第一层轨迹的Z值和对于轮廓的偏置量,这个角度变化量就是圆心角的增量。圆角半径值小,圆心角增量可大一些,反之则应该小一些,理想的结果应该按弧长进行计算。圆心角增量值按绝对值给出。
% `$ y P& b) r$ ?. j3 D(3)圆角起始角: 0 M5 Y) O# p/ ?7 q5 I
加工圆角时的开始角。一般应设为“0”,不允许小于结束角。
$ V/ o) y% _. K4 @3 k6 t- Q(4)圆角结束角:
8 f) V/ w! s/ w7 d加工圆角时的结束角。一般应设为“90”,不允许大于开始角。
; M0 S% ^& C# V/ |% s, R(5)切入直线长:
% _3 Q- p- Z, _每一层轨迹从加工工艺上考虑需要从工件外切入,从编程上考虑由于使用了机床偏置,每一层轨迹都需要有一个加入机床偏置和取消机床偏置的程序段,这一段直线就是切入直线。它的长度要求大于刀具半径。 ) a. z4 P1 s1 X7 G3 t& N
(6)偏置方向: * t# ]; j' a3 e; [6 R. M& c
左偏:向被加工曲线的左边进行偏置。左方向的判断方法与G41相同,即刀具加工方向的左边。 ; {+ D6 a9 j$ g+ ^5 H
右偏:向被加工曲线的右边进行偏置。右方向的判断方法与G42相同,即刀具加工方向的右边。 4 X/ U) A4 q9 F
(7)由外轮廓生成轨迹
; [6 }' ], c6 H# c9 p由被加工零件的外轮廓生成倒圆角加工轨迹。反之则是由圆角与上平面的切线所形成的轮廓的加工轨迹。二个轮廓根据这个选项勾选的不同可以生成相同的加工轨迹和宏程序。具体的轮廓选择可见图3所示 ; ^1 u5 O: i* R& _3 g: @! n
% |9 Y* {6 J6 y4 d
图3 轮廓生成加工轨迹4 C! S3 W+ _0 d" {' K `
(8)显示真实轨迹
' I9 O9 c8 ^. G A真实轨迹是用宏程序加工时实际要走的轨迹,它只是作为显示用。真正生成的加工程序仍然是宏程序。 $ {( w" l3 t+ w
(9)安全高度;刀具在此高度以上任何位置,均不会碰伤工件和夹具。 + ]' ?) r# r, ?: t6 p
(10)加工精度:输入模型的加工误差。计算模型的轨迹的误差小于此值。加工误差越大,模型形状的误差也增大,模型表面越粗糙。加工精度越小,模型形状的误差也减小,模型表面越光滑,但是,轨迹段的数目增多,轨迹数据量变大。 % T" b! a, W2 s; ?/ M
2、生成代码
1 _0 W5 z/ C0 S7 z: H3 \+ r生成G代码选择后置处理的第二种方式来生成G代码,这样就可以根据具体的数控系统来生成后置代码了。代码生成设置如图4所示。 6 p7 ]' ~4 w P& }, ]# Y
(注意:1.代码生成支持球铣、端铣刀和R铣刀。2.代码生成:生成加工代码请选用后置文件“Fanuc_m”) 1 p. U1 S9 Y/ E% t
9 [3 c* M' P& i; I生成的代码中包含了宏指令,上例生成的代码如下。代码中的中文字在输入到机床时要删除掉,在这里只是为了让读者容易理解程序。#2(圆角增量)可根据加工的需要进行调整。 1 U7 T% n" B& B8 O9 r
% " |- J. Q6 c+ K
O1200
0 I7 Z, C3 ~- M, b2 T# yN10 T0 M6 ' w0 e- w' P3 U: h
N12 G90 G54 G0 X62.86 Y-160.76 S3000 M03
9 Y7 w. C( b9 r; IN14 G43 H0 Z15. M07 % Y& Q$ U+ y' s/ [
N16 #1=0.000000 ;(起始角度); 8 ^) S1 T9 W+ q2 P. u" B7 a
N18 #2=8.000000 ;(角度增量); & U) W1 K4 d& Y$ R
N20 #3=90.000000 ;(终止角); 9 {9 M' s) g9 Y; l
N22 #2=#3/ROUND[#3/#2+0.5] ;(修正后的角度增量);
) _ x3 V! s, Q$ L' r; x' gN24 #4=5.000000 ;(圆角半径); 6 j% ?! o; }7 \* `! G9 S( F
N26 #5=5 ;(球刀半径);
+ X0 k- F) s0 y1 VN28 #15=5 -#5 ;(刀具半径);
7 _; N/ s+ I- N6 C: t2 |; VN30 #8=15 ;(轮廓线所在的高度Z值);
' B+ v( Y4 {* y) m/ {N32 WHILE[#1 LE #3] DO1; (循环直到#1小于等于#3时停止) ; + k8 W% R3 b( E$ t) C7 h
N34 #6=#8-#4+[#4+#5]*COS[#1]-#5 ; (深度) ; ) R! x& W5 T$ A( M
N36 #7=#15+[#4+#5]*SIN[#1]-#4; (径向补偿); 9 L# k5 Y. t" y4 m; s6 z/ F
N38 G10L12P0 R#7; (将径向补偿值#7输入机床中);
( _5 Z9 i6 h0 J, G3 n, KN40 G1 G41 D0 X47.186 Y-163.971 F1000
: n9 a3 ~3 r) U6 n. W( S4 }N42 G17 G2 X40. Y-196. I-39.186 J-8.029 & [! L6 R# B5 j& p3 f
N44 X-68. Y-160. I-48. J36.
3 K2 {% _/ k( W" u# H% B……
# T4 G* }. F: U3 A5 Z& v/ eN76 M05 6 `8 S4 u4 B2 B0 C2 P/ Z4 W
N78 M30 . X: Q# r8 I$ t2 E# {) v
%
2 g3 S! a9 j( c4 E T三、 总结 * ^% ?# h0 F8 h/ t+ d8 V; t6 d
本文主要介绍了制造工程师加工环节中的宏加工的加工方式,这样使制造工程师的加工方法更多样化,在实际加工过程中也更游刃有余。而CAXA制造工程师也增加了相应的其他更强大的功能,将使整个CAXA制造工程师软件更完善更便利。
5 e: z6 h7 ~) y6 hCAXA制造工程师数控编程软件产品集CAD、CAM于一体,并以其完全自主知识产权和精湛的技术实力,现在已经得到了日益广泛的普及和应用,并受到好评。随着信息化需求的不断增加,市场更加期望有能够与CAD系统相匹配的、功能强大、更符合加工工程化概念、易于普及的新一代CAM产品,CAXA制造工程师2008版正是为了满足企业此类日益增长的需求而推出的,企业以CAXA产品为主线,将使企业构建数字化工厂完全能够做到快捷、实用。CAXA制造工程师数编程软件,现正在一个更高的起点上腾飞 |
|